Residents Threaten To Drag Museveni, Gov’t To East African Court Over Illegal Land Evictions, Failed Compensation
A photo montage of Kabuleta and Museveni The locals of Sebei Sub region have resolved to drag President Yoweri Museveni along with his government to the East African Court of Justice over illegal land evictions and failed compensation. The mineral-rich region is made of three districts namely;-Kween, Bukwo and Kapchorwa.
